What is the Verbal Order Form for Lab Tests?

The Verbal Order Form for Lab Tests is an essential document in healthcare that authorizes the execution of lab tests for patients. This form requires a doctor's signature to verify the verbal orders given, ensuring accountability and compliance with medical protocols. The form is also referred to as a medical lab test consent form, emphasizing its role in obtaining patient consent for necessary lab tests.

Key Features of the Verbal Order Form for Lab Tests

The Verbal Order Form includes several key components designed to maximize usability. Essential fields cover patient details, such as name and relevant medical information, along with a section for listing specific lab tests ordered. Additionally, it requires signatures from both the doctor and the discipline accepting the orders, enhancing the form's credibility as a doctor signature lab order. Common Errors and How to Avoid Them

When filling out the verbal order form, users frequently encounter several common errors that can lead to delays or rejections. Common mistakes include incomplete patient details and missing signatures. To enhance accuracy, double-check all entries before submission and ensure that both required signatures are properly executed.
